The screenless hammer mill, like regular hammer mills, is used to pound grain.However, rather than a screen, it uses air flow to separate small particles from larger ones. Conventional hammer mills in poor and remote areas, such as many parts of Africa, suffer from the problem that screens break easily, and cannot be easily bought, made or repaired.

A mill is a device that breaks solid materials into smaller pieces by grinding, crushing, or cutting. Such comminution is an important unit operation in many processes.There are many different types of mills and many types of materials processed in them. Historically mills were powered by hand (e.g., via a hand crank), working animal (e.g., horse mill), wind or water ().

Flintshire countryside manager John Richards said: "The collection of buildings below Meadow Villas off the Holywell to Greenfield road were constructed in 1787 by Thomas Williams, known locally as the Copper King, and housed the rolling and hammer mill of the Greenfield Copper and Brass Company, where copper sheets, bolts and nails were made from copper brought from the Parys Mine in Anglesey.
